Advice and help would be appreciated to get rid of a little nagging problem I've had with Free Republic.

For some reason, whenever I initially open the Free Republic website, I get the list of articles posted on Aug. 21, 2012. The right-hand column of articles is up to date, however. I've hit refresh and looked through my settings, and everything seems fine there - although I know that there could be dozens, maybe hundreds of settings I'm unaware of.

In any case, I'm exceptionally tired of seeing those same articles about the senatorial candidate from Missouri filling my screen with the same stories over and over.

When I go to an article in the right-hand column and then move back to the main page (almost always "news and activism"), voila! I get the latest articles.

Anyhow, if someone out there can tell me a way around this very, very small problem, I'd appreciate hearing about it.
